Technical Specifications
Airframe & Performance
- Model: HS-P134M
- Configuration: Quadcopter (4 rotors)
- Frame Material: T300 Carbon Fiber with injection nylon parts
- Empty Weight: 1900g (without battery)
- Max Takeoff Weight (MTOW): 11kg
- Rated Payload: 6-7kg
- Max Payload: 7kg
- Max Speed: 130km/h
- Angular Speed: 670°/s (Pitch/Roll/Yaw)
- Flight Time (No Load): 30+ minutes
- Hover Time (6kg Payload): 11 minutes
- Wind Resistance: Level 6 (20-30 km/h)
- Operating Temperature: -10°C to 40°C (estimated)
Propulsion System
- Motors: 4× 440KV Brushless (1569W each)
- Propellers: 332mm 3-blade
- ESC: 4× 80A split ESC with AM32 firmware
- PDB: 100A with 5V/12V BEC and current sensing
- Operating Voltage: 8S LiPo
- Recommended Battery: 8S 7500mAh 70C LiPo
Flight Controller & Electronics
- Flight Controller: STM32F405
- Blackbox: 16MB onboard logging
- Firmware: Betaflight
- GPS: Optional module (±1m RTH, ±0.5m hover accuracy)
- Telemetry: Full ESC telemetry support
Communication & FPV
- Receiver: ELRS 915MHz (customizable)
- Control Range: 10km+
- Operating Frequency: 5.8 GHz
- VTX: 3W, 72 channels, IRC Tramp protocol
- Camera: 1500TVL FPV camera
- Camera FOV: 135°
- Lens: 2.1mm
- Camera Features: D-WDR (Dynamic Wide Dynamic Range)
- Video Format: PAL/NTSC support
- Video Resolution: 1080P (1920×1080)
- Sensor Size: 1/3.0 inch
- Antenna: MMCX-to-SMA cable included
